The best time to visit Beijing is during the spring (April-May) or autumn (September-October). The weather is mild and pleasant, and you can avoid the summer heat and winter cold.
From Beijing Capital International Airport (PEK), you can take the Airport Express train to the city center for about 25 RMB. Taxis are also available, costing around 100 RMB depending on the distance.
Visit the Forbidden City: Explore the former imperial palace and its vast courtyards. Walk the Great Wall: Hike a section of this iconic landmark. Explore the Temple of Heaven: Admire the traditional architecture and serene gardens. See Tiananmen Square: Witness the grandeur of this historic public square.
Try Peking roast duck, a famous culinary specialty. Sample jiaozi (dumplings) and zhajiangmian (noodles with savory soybean paste).
Learn a few basic Mandarin phrases, as English is not widely spoken. Download a translation app and a local map for offline use.
